HeavyDSparks crushes 70 "sports cars"
So, no sure if anyone has been aware of this, this took place over the last two days. Video was released and then made private within just a few short hours do to backlash. Heavy D basically bought a whole lot of used Datsun and Nissan Z cars, 70 plus of them, then smugly on camera crushed them and transported for scrap metal. After just a couple hours was loosing numbers of subscribers. The only thing I have dug up or found was a Reddit post. Anyone else hear about this?

Real car guys and gear heads appreciate all different types of automobiles. You don’t have to like them all or even care about them, but you should respect that others do. I personally don’t like big rims with skinny tired lifted to high heaven pickup trucks, but given the chance, I’m not gonna crush any of them bc, one, idgaf enough to expend the energy, and two, I’m not an azzhole. Btw, it is irrelevant if those cars were in HIS opinion beyond salvaging, bc at a minimum, they were parts cars for someone else’s project. And, as older cars become more scarce, cars that were once not worth saving become viable restoration candidates. Look at 60s and early 70s mopars foe example, folks will restore some truly shitbox examples that 25-30years ago would’ve been left to rot. |
